Lake George man charged with Arson

A 26 year-old Lake George man has been charged with arson in connection with an August 14 fire at 2777 Dell road in Frost Township.

Jessie Lee Smith was arrested September 14 and arraigned on one count of Arson – Real Property in 80th District Court under Magistrate Rick LaBoda September 15. A preliminary examination has been set for September 28 at 2 p.m.

According to the Clare County Sheriff’s Department, the CCSD Fire Investigator was called to the fire scene where he found that a garage on property had been set on fire. Two witnesses claimed to have seen suspects at the scene at the time of the fire.

The Investigator determined after interviewing the two that one of the witnesses was actually the suspect in the arson case. Smith was interviewed about his involvement, and a warrant was issued for his arrest.

He faces up to ten years in prison if found guilty of the charges. Smith’s bond was set at $5,000 personal recognizance and he was released.
